This day we had a walk, for this country we had planned plenty of hikes, this one a 5h hike called "Round the mountain", starting in Akaroa and finishing as well.
The first 2 hours were constantly going up, some parts very steep, but the weather was perfect, cloudy enough to not let the sun burn out skin, and warm enough. It was a wonderful walk through the bushes and Autumn forest, green tones were everywhere.
We summited the highest point in about 2h 30min, just behind the mountains which allowed us to see a different bay, mesmerizing view with a snack.
After that, we continue towards Akaroa, and this part wasn't easier despite going downhill, knees were suffering from that, and surprisingly it was very steep as well, thanks to the view for healing all pain.
We arrived back in Akaroa about 15:30h ready for a late and quick lunch. And then we drove all the way to Okains Bay for the overnight camping. The drive was spectacular as well, can't believe this peninsula was formed from a volcano eruption and how incredibly beautiful it is.
